=====1953=====
 
 
* and also: transl. as The Function of Language in Psychoanalysis by Anthony Wilden in The Language of the Self: The Function of Language in Psychoanalysis, Johns Hopkins Press, Baltimore, 1968.
* Letter to Rudolph Löwenstein, July 14, transl. by Jeffrey Mehlman in 'Dossier on the International Debate' in October 40, Spring 1987.
=====1976=====
* A Lacanian Psychosis: Interview by Jacques Lacan, 13 Feb. 1976, transl. by Stuart Schneiderman (ed.), in Returning to Freud: Clinical Psychoanalysis in the School of Lacan, Yale University, 1980.
=====1980=====
* A Letter to 'Le Monde', transl. by Jeffrey Mehlman in October 40, Spring 1987.
* Letter of Dissolution. from Seminar XXVII, transl. by O. Zentner (ed.) in Papers of the Freudian School of Melbourne, PIT Press, 1980. In Autres Écrits, Paris: Seuil, 2001.
* The Other is Missing from Seminar XXVII, transl. by Jeffrey Mehlman in October 40, Spring 1987.
* The Seminar XXVII, Paris, 10 June 1980. transl. by O. Zentner (ed.) in Papers of The Freudian School of Melbourne, PIT Press, 1981.
* The Seminar XXVII, Caracas, 12 July 1980. transl. by O. Zentner (ed.) in Papers of The Freudian School of Melbourne, PIT Press, 1981.
